Process migration
Using binary translators, would it be possible capture the runtime image (instructions and data) of processes and translate these so that the process can run from where it left on a machine with a different architecture? This will be useful for migrating applications to heterogenous systems for purposes of high availability.

ptree(1) General Commands Manual ptree(1)
NAME
ptree - prints the process tree hierarchy
SYNOPSIS
[pid1|username1 [pid2|username2]...]
DESCRIPTION
prints the process tree of all processes that match the specified arguments. While printing the tree, the child processes are indented to
the right from their respective parent processes.
Options
Prints the tree starting from the children of
(usually pid 0). The default is to print the tree starting from the children of (pid 1).
Operands
pid Print the process tree for the process ID number specified by pid.
username Print the process tree for all the processes from the user specified by username. Note that only username (and not user ID) can
be specified for this instance.
If no operands are specified, then prints the process tree of all processes starting from the children of or (if is specified).
